Look around the handle first, there is always at least a screw, if not 2 there. Next look around the outside edges of the door panel for more screws. Sometimes they hide them under carpeted sections, run your hands over them feeling for holes. if there are pwr window or locks normally the panel will come off, sometimes screws under there as well. If you think you have them all, genty pull on the bottom corner and the panel should start to pop off. If it is sticking somewhere then try to see what is holding it. Work your way around the outside edges until the panel comes off. Copyright ClubKnowledge 2009 * All Rights Reserved |
